Discover Birmingham’s Prime Real Estate Market

Birmingham, known for its vibrant culture and rich history, is rapidly emerging as a prime destination for real estate investors. With a diverse economy and an influx of businesses, the city offers a unique blend of opportunities for both homebuyers and investors. Let's delve into what makes Birmingham's real estate market so attractive.

One of the significant factors contributing to the surge in Birmingham's real estate market is its affordability compared to other major cities in the UK. House prices in Birmingham have remained comparatively low, attracting first-time buyers and families looking for more space without breaking the bank. The average property price in Birmingham is significantly below the national average, making it a hotspot for investment.

Additionally, Birmingham's economic growth is a driving force behind its real estate boom. The city has been experiencing a renaissance, with new businesses and startups emerging in various sectors, including technology, finance, and healthcare. This economic vitality fuels demand for housing as new professionals relocate to Birmingham, seeking both rental opportunities and properties to purchase.

Investors are particularly keen on Birmingham due to its comprehensive transport network. The city boasts excellent connectivity, with direct trains to London, Manchester, and other major cities, making it an attractive location for commuters. Moreover, the ongoing development of the HS2 (High-Speed 2) rail project is expected to further enhance Birmingham's connectivity, potentially increasing property values in the surrounding areas.

The Birmingham property market is also characterized by its diverse range of properties. From historic Victorian houses to modern apartments, there is something for everyone. Areas such as Edgbaston, Moseley, and Stirchley are particularly popular among buyers and renters alike. These neighborhoods not only offer charming residential options but also vibrant local communities, appealing to young professionals and families.

Furthermore, Birmingham is home to numerous educational institutions, including the University of Birmingham and Aston University, attracting a steady stream of students. This demographic ensures a robust rental market, making buy-to-let properties a lucrative investment for landlords. With a growing population of students and recent graduates, the demand for rental properties continues to grow.

In terms of future developments, the Birmingham City Council has ambitious plans to revitalize various parts of the city. Initiatives aimed at improving public spaces, enhancing infrastructure, and creating more green areas will undoubtedly make Birmingham a more attractive place to live and invest in. These improvements not only raise the appeal of the city but also contribute to increasing property values over time.
